There's rarely a dull moment at the US Open. And how could there be, with the high-stakes, high-pressure, high-speed nature of it all?

This month, hundreds of devoted tennis fans will swarm Arthur Ashe Stadium for a glimpse at tennis greatness. Luckily, for those watching at home, the internet will be rife with coverage from the US Open. There will be moments ranging from the epic to the tragic to the downright bizarre, and many will be replayed over and over and over again in the form of GIFs.

To get you amped up for what’s to come this year, we're revisiting some of our favorite GIFs from US Opens past. We hope you love them as much as we do.

Do the splits

Via Giphy

The outstanding athleticism isn't just limited to tennis skills at the US Open – sometimes there's some gymnastics involved. Serena Williams is known for doing everything she can to get to the ball, even if that means dropping into a mean split on the court.

The ol' through-the-legs move

Via Giphy

Sometimes tennis stars can't help but show off a little. Take Roger Federer, for instance: He can hit an ace shot, backwards, through his legs. That's nuts.
